Country music singer-songwriter Willie Nelson will go home from the American Music Awards on Jan. 30. with a special award of merit for career achievement. Another 22 awards will be handed out in pop-rock, soul-rhythm and blues, country, rap, and heavy metal categories. Dick Clark is producing the award show, which will be seen on ABC-TV. Nelson, known for his song-writing and acting successes, also has organized the Farm Aid concerts to help beleaguered family farms in the United States.
